虚拟主机是通过Web服务器提供的服务来托管网站的一种方式,它允许用户在无需购买独立服务器的情况下,使用共享服务器空间来运行他们的网站。,关于虚拟主机的源代码,并没有官方提供的源代码,因为虚拟主机的主要功能是由其软件和操作系统实现的,这些系统包括Web服务器、数据库管理器等,它们提供了虚拟主机所需的基本功能和服务。,如果您需要开发自己的虚拟主机解决方案,您可以选择开源的Web服务器软件(如Apache或Nginx)以及数据库管理系统(如MySQL或PostgreSQL),然后自己编写相应的脚本和配置文件来定制化您的虚拟主机环境,这样您就可以拥有完全自定义的虚拟主机解决方案,而不必依赖于任何预装好的虚拟主机平台。
在互联网时代,拥有自己的网站和域名已经成为许多企业和个人展示自己、推广产品和服务的重要手段,而为了实现这个目标,很多人会选择使用虚拟主机服务来托管他们的网站,对于很多用户来说,他们可能会好奇,虚拟主机的源代码究竟位于何处?本文将为您解答这一问题。
首先需要澄清的是,虚拟主机并不是一个软件或者程序,而是硬件设备上运行的一组服务器系统,用于存储网站文件并提供给用户访问,从技术层面来看,并没有“源代码”这种概念存在于虚拟主机中,我们可以通过解析和理解虚拟主机系统的配置文件和脚本文件,来了解其工作原理和功能设计。
尽管虚拟主机本身并不包含源代码,但通过分析用户的配置文件(如Apache或Nginx的配置文件),可以了解到服务器端使用的编程语言及其版本信息,如果你看到的是一个用PHP编写的网站,那么很可能你的服务器就安装了PHP环境,这意味着服务器上存在源代码,这些源代码通常不会直接可见,而是被压缩后保存在服务器上的某个目录下,只有经过特定工具才能查看和访问。
另一种方法是通过Web日志来寻找源代码,当用户浏览网站时,浏览器会向服务器发送请求,服务器根据请求生成响应,服务器的日志文件记录下了所有这些请求和响应,通过对这些日志文件的深入分析,我们可以找到一些关于编程语言和源代码的关键线索。
如果发现某条日志中有大量的异常处理逻辑或者复杂的算法描述,这可能意味着服务器正在运行某些自定义的框架或应用,而不是默认的web服务器,进一步查找相关日志文件或配置文件,就可以定位到具体的源代码。
在尝试获取虚拟主机的源代码时,需要注意以下几点:
虽然虚拟主机本身不包含源代码,但通过合理的分析和利用,仍然有可能找到相关信息,务必谨慎行事,遵守相关法律法规和道德准则。
热卖推荐 上云必备低价长效云服务器99元/1年,OSS 低至 118.99 元/1年,官方优选推荐
热卖推荐 香港、美国、韩国、日本、限时优惠 立刻购买